Overview

Eric Penley is a strong, business-minded trial lawyer and advocate for construction/AEC industry clients and other businesses in pre-litigation, litigation, mediation, and arbitration involving commercial disputes, construction, real estate, and professional liability issues.

Eric drafts, negotiates, and enforces complex written agreements on behalf of contractors, subcontractors, project owners, and design professionals. He also provides strategic legal guidance and representation throughout every phase of a project, including early dispute resolution.

Eric has a proven history of successfully representing clients in matters before arbitrators, Massachusetts Superior Courts, US District Courts, and US Courts of Appeals. 

Prior to joining MG+M, Eric was an attorney at litigation and trial firms in Massachusetts, including at a multinational AmLaw 20 firm. Before attending law school, he worked as a paralegal in the Antitrust Division of the US Department of Justice.
